Florida State's Curriculum & Instruction: Special Education graduate program equips educators and service professionals with skills to recognize and implement research-backed teaching methods. Students gain deep expertise in special education fields while receiving personalized guidance from faculty mentors. Tailored for working professionals, this program bridges academic concepts with real-world application.
Ranked #16 among public universities by U.S. News and World Report, our Special Education program develops skilled practitioners capable of improving lives for people with disabilities across all age groups. Faculty members consistently conduct groundbreaking research that advances both support systems and societal awareness for individuals with special needs.

The program provides on-campus specialist and doctoral degree options.

At the specialist and doctoral levels, students collaborate with faculty advisors to define their academic focus and customize coursework for targeted professional development.

Qualification Requirements

A bachelor's degree with at least a 3.0 GPA An earned bachelor's degree from a regionally accredited U.S. institution, or a comparable degree from an international institution, with a minimum 3.0 (on a 4.0 scale) grade point average (GPA) in all coursework attempted while registered as an upper-division undergraduate student working towards a bachelor's degree.
GRE test scores. Official test results are required from the General Test of the Graduate Record Examination (GRE). These scores are considered official only when they are sent directly to the Office of Admissions from the testing agency.
Ph.D. applicant target scores: Verbal 151+, Quantitative 145+, Writing 3+
The GRE requirements for master's and specialist programs have been waived through Fall 2026.
Language proficiency test (international students only) FSU accepts scores from TOEFL (minimum 80), IELTS (minimum 6.5), MELAB (minimum 77), Cambridge C1 Advanced Level (minimum 180), Michigan Language Assessment (minimum 55), and Duolingo (minimum 120)
Transcripts Applicants must submit an official transcript from each college and/or university attended.

Admission to graduate study is a two-fold evaluation process. The Office of Admissions determines eligibility for admission to the University, and the academic department, program, or college determines admissibility to the degree program.
Applicants must upload the following REQUIRED supporting documents to the Admissions Application Portal:

Statement of purpose should describe your purpose for pursuing a degree, qualifications and long-term career goals.
At least two (2) pages for Ph.D. applicants
Letters of recommendation
Three (3) for Ph.D. applicants
One page resume/curriculum vitae
Writing Sample it is acceptable to submit a paper used in another class, or one that was published.
